Northrop Grumman’s Space Sector is seeking a Pr./Sr Principal Systems Engineer Level 3 or Level 4 to join our team in Dulles, VA. This position is 100% onsite and cannot accommodate telecommute work.

The job responsibilities will be as an individual-contributor and deliverable/product lead within a multi-disciplinary engineering team, specifically supporting functions related to Fault Management and System Autonomy (FMSA) for space systems.

This position will work a 9/80 schedule, with every other Friday off.

Your Role and Impact:

  • Perform traditional Systems Engineering functions, including requirements synthesis and flow-down, verification/validation planning, system trades study support, systems analysis, coordination of design efforts, and management of technical budgets & interface definitions
  • The application of these systems engineering functions will be in the context of fault management, system autonomy
  • The candidate must be able to assist in the formulation of system design, definition of concept of operations, and systems analysis for failure modes and effects, including their identification and mitigation through autonomous or operational controls
  • Designing, implementing, and validating Fault Management and System Autonomy Flight Software using flight-like simulations and flight hardware
  • Must be knowledgeable in spacecraft subsystem design, spacecraft testing, flight software best practices, and mission operations
  • Candidate may be called on to assist in new business activities, such as conceptual design and analysis for proposals and funded studies and may include authoring sections for both
  • Presentation skills and the ability to communicate complex technical concepts to either technical or nontechnical audiences is required

 Preferred Qualifications:  

  • Failure analysis or fault management technical experience
  • Experience defining requirements & interfaces
  • Understanding of spacecraft integration & test, launch, and mission operations
  • Experience developing verification documentation
  • Experience with architecture development
  • Experience with spacecraft mission operations
  • Familiarity with electrical & computer systems
  • Familiarity with command and telemetry databases
